Web1 jul. 2024 · Oregon just became the eighth state in the country to pass a paid family leave bill, giving 12 weeks of paid time off to new parents, victims of domestic violence and people who need to care of an ill family member or themselves. The state Senate passed the law Sunday night, 21-6, with four Republican senators joining the Democratic majority. Web28 okt. 2024 · The new law applies to all employers in the state of Oregon who have at least one employee. But in order to be eligible to receive paid family leave benefits, an employee must have received $1,000 or more in wages in the base year. Significantly, Oregon has a broad definition of “family member” in terms of the law.
